Daniel Nester is a writer, editor, and poet from Maple Shade Township, New Jersey. Maple Shade Township is a Township in Burlington County, New Jersey, United States.
Contents |
Nester is the author of two books about the musical group Queen, and his obsession with them: God Save My Queen: A Tribute and God Save My Queen II: The Show Must Go On. His first book of poetry is The History of My World Tonight.
